hs293go 2b89ce66f0 Add generalized Euler Angle conversions
Conversions function include Euler Angles to / from Rotation Matrices
and Quaternions. They are generalized for any Euler convention that can
be specified in the arguments. Algorithm is from "Euler angle
conversion", Ken Shoemake, Graphics Gems IV

// Use as:
// double expected_quaternion[4];
// double actual_quaternion[4];
// EXPECT_THAT(actual_quaternion, IsNearQuaternion(expected_quaternion));
MATCHER_P(IsNearQuaternion, expected, "") {
// Quaternions are equivalent upto a sign change. So we will compare
// both signs before declaring failure.
bool is_near = true;
// NOTE: near (and far) can be defined as macros on the Windows platform (for
// ancient pascal calling convention). Do not use these identifiers.
for (int i = 0; i < 4; i++) {
if (fabs(arg[i] - expected[i]) > kTolerance) {
is_near = false;
break;
}
}
if (is_near) {
return true;
}
is_near = true;
for (int i = 0; i < 4; i++) {
if (fabs(arg[i] + expected[i]) > kTolerance) {
is_near = false;
break;
}
}
if (is_near) {
return true;
}
// clang-format off
*result_listener << "expected : "
<< expected[0] << " "
<< expected[1] << " "
<< expected[2] << " "
<< expected[3] << " "
<< "actual : "
<< arg[0] << " "
<< arg[1] << " "
<< arg[2] << " "
<< arg[3];
// clang-format on
return false;
}

template <typename T>
struct GeneralEulerAngles : public ::testing::Test {
public:
static constexpr bool kIsParityOdd = T::kIsParityOdd;
static constexpr bool kIsProperEuler = T::kIsProperEuler;
static constexpr bool kIsIntrinsic = T::kIsIntrinsic;
template <typename URBG>
static void RandomEulerAngles(double* euler, URBG& prng) {
using ParamType = std::uniform_real_distribution<double>::param_type;
std::uniform_real_distribution<double> uniform_distribution{-kPi, kPi};
// Euler angles should be in
// [-pi,pi) x [0,pi) x [-pi,pi])
// if the outer axes are repeated and
// [-pi,pi) x [-pi/2,pi/2) x [-pi,pi])
// otherwise
euler[0] = uniform_distribution(prng);
euler[2] = uniform_distribution(prng);
if constexpr (kIsProperEuler) {
euler[1] = uniform_distribution(prng, ParamType{0, kPi});
} else {
euler[1] = uniform_distribution(prng, ParamType{-kPi / 2, kPi / 2});
}
}
static void CheckPrincipalRotationMatrixProduct(double angles[3]) {
// Convert Shoemake's Euler angle convention into 'apparent' rotation axes
// sequences, i.e. the alphabetic code (ZYX, ZYZ, etc.) indicates in what
// sequence rotations about different axes are applied
constexpr int i = T::kAxes[0];
constexpr int j = (3 + (kIsParityOdd ? (i - 1) % 3 : (i + 1) % 3)) % 3;
constexpr int k = kIsProperEuler ? i : 3 ^ i ^ j;
constexpr auto kSeq =
kIsIntrinsic ? std::array{k, j, i} : std::array{i, j, k};
double aa_matrix[9];
Eigen::Map<Eigen::Matrix3d, 0, Eigen::Stride<1, 3>> aa(aa_matrix);
aa.setIdentity();
for (int i = 0; i < 3; ++i) {
Eigen::Vector3d angle_axis;
if constexpr (kIsIntrinsic) {
angle_axis = -angles[i] * Eigen::Vector3d::Unit(kSeq[i]);
} else {
angle_axis = angles[i] * Eigen::Vector3d::Unit(kSeq[i]);
}
Eigen::Matrix3d m;
AngleAxisToRotationMatrix(angle_axis.data(), m.data());
aa = m * aa;
}
if constexpr (kIsIntrinsic) {
aa.transposeInPlace();
}
double ea_matrix[9];
EulerAnglesToRotation<T>(angles, ea_matrix);
EXPECT_THAT(aa_matrix, IsOrthonormal());
EXPECT_THAT(ea_matrix, IsOrthonormal());
EXPECT_THAT(ea_matrix, IsNear3x3Matrix(aa_matrix));
}
};

// Gimbal lock (euler[1] == +/-pi) handling test. If a rotation matrix
// represents a gimbal-locked configuration, then converting this rotation
// matrix to euler angles and back must produce the same rotation matrix.
//
// From scipy/spatial/transform/test/test_rotation.py, but additionally covers
// gimbal lock handling for proper euler angles, which scipy appears to fail to
// do properly.
TYPED_TEST(GeneralEulerAngles, GimbalLocked) {
constexpr auto kBoundaryAngles = TestFixture::kIsProperEuler
? std::array{0.0, kPi}
: std::array{-kPi / 2, kPi / 2};
constexpr double gimbal_locked_configurations[4][3] = {
{0.78539816, kBoundaryAngles[1], 0.61086524},
{0.61086524, kBoundaryAngles[0], 0.34906585},
{0.61086524, kBoundaryAngles[1], 0.43633231},
{0.43633231, kBoundaryAngles[0], 0.26179939}};
double angle_estimates[3];
double mat_expected[9];
double mat_estimated[9];
for (const auto& euler_angles : gimbal_locked_configurations) {
EulerAnglesToRotation<TypeParam>(euler_angles, mat_expected);
RotationMatrixToEulerAngles<TypeParam>(mat_expected, angle_estimates);
EulerAnglesToRotation<TypeParam>(angle_estimates, mat_estimated);
ASSERT_THAT(mat_expected, IsNear3x3Matrix(mat_estimated));
}
}
